# 是否为网络接口和应用层协议的监控设定了最小必要的监控指标?
## 引言
在当今数字化时代,网络安全已成为企业和组织不可忽视的重要议题。网络接口和应用层协议作为数据传输的关键环节,其安全性直接影响到整个网络系统的稳定性和数据的安全性。然而,许多组织在监控这些关键环节时,往往缺乏系统性和全面性,未能设定最小必要的监控指标。本文将结合AI技术在网络安全领域的应用,详细分析这一问题,并提出详实的解决方案。
## 一、网络接口和应用层协议监控的重要性
### 1.1 网络接口的安全隐患
网络接口是数据进出网络系统的门户,任何未经授权的访问或恶意攻击都可能通过这些接口进行。常见的网络接口包括路由器、交换机、防火墙等设备。若这些接口缺乏有效的监控,黑客便可能利用漏洞进行渗透,进而窃取或篡改数据。
### 1.2 应用层协议的安全风险
应用层协议如HTTP、HTTPS、FTP等,是应用层与传输层之间的桥梁,负责数据的封装和解析。由于应用层协议种类繁多,且每种协议都可能存在特定的安全漏洞,若不进行细致的监控,极易成为攻击者的突破口。
## 二、最小必要监控指标的设定原则
### 2.1 全面性原则
监控指标应涵盖网络接口和应用层协议的所有关键环节,确保无死角监控。例如,对于网络接口,应监控流量、连接数、异常行为等;对于应用层协议,应监控请求类型、响应时间、异常请求等。
### 2.2 精准性原则
监控指标应具备较高的精准度,能够准确识别和预警潜在的安全威胁。例如,通过设定流量阈值,及时发现异常流量;通过分析请求内容,识别恶意请求。
### 2.3 实时性原则
监控指标应具备实时性,能够及时发现和响应安全事件。例如,通过实时监控日志,快速发现异常行为并进行处置。
## 三、AI技术在网络安全监控中的应用
### 3.1 异常检测
AI技术可以通过机器学习和深度学习算法,对网络流量和应用层协议数据进行实时分析,识别出异常行为。例如,利用聚类算法对正常流量进行建模,当检测到与正常模式显著不同的流量时,即可触发预警。
### 3.2 恶意代码识别
AI技术可以通过自然语言处理和模式识别技术,对应用层协议中的数据进行深度分析,识别出潜在的恶意代码。例如,利用神经网络对HTTP请求内容进行特征提取,识别出包含恶意代码的请求。
### 3.3 行为分析
AI技术可以通过行为分析算法,对用户和系统的行为进行建模,识别出异常行为。例如,利用时间序列分析对用户登录行为进行建模,当检测到异常登录行为时,即可触发预警。
## 四、最小必要监控指标的设定方案
### 4.1 网络接口监控指标
#### 4.1.1 流量监控
- **入口流量**:监控进入网络接口的数据流量,设定流量阈值,及时发现异常流量。
- **出口流量**:监控离开网络接口的数据流量,设定流量阈值,及时发现异常流量。
- **流量速率**:监控流量的变化速率,识别突发流量。
#### 4.1.2 连接数监控
- **活跃连接数**:监控当前活跃的连接数,设定阈值,及时发现异常连接。
- **新建连接速率**:监控新建连接的速率,识别异常连接行为。
#### 4.1.3 异常行为监控
- **非法访问尝试**:监控非法访问尝试的次数,识别潜在的攻击行为。
- **端口扫描**:监控端口扫描行为,识别潜在的攻击行为。
### 4.2 应用层协议监控指标
#### 4.2.1 请求类型监控
- **请求类型分布**:监控不同类型请求的分布情况,识别异常请求。
- **异常请求比例**:监控异常请求的比例,识别潜在的攻击行为。
#### 4.2.2 响应时间监控
- **平均响应时间**:监控应用层协议的平均响应时间,识别性能异常。
- **最大响应时间**:监控应用层协议的最大响应时间,识别潜在的攻击行为。
#### 4.2.3 异常请求内容监控
- **恶意代码检测**:利用AI技术对请求内容进行深度分析,识别潜在的恶意代码。
- **请求参数异常**:监控请求参数的异常情况,识别潜在的攻击行为。
## 五、实施策略与建议
### 5.1 建立完善的监控体系
组织应建立完善的网络接口和应用层协议监控体系,确保所有关键环节都纳入监控范围。同时,应定期对监控体系进行评估和优化,确保其有效性和全面性。
### 5.2 引入AI技术提升监控效能
组织应积极引入AI技术,提升监控的精准性和实时性。例如,利用机器学习算法对网络流量进行异常检测,利用深度学习算法对应用层协议数据进行恶意代码识别。
### 5.3 加强人员培训与应急响应
组织应加强网络安全人员的培训,提升其监控和应急响应能力。同时,应建立完善的应急响应机制,确保在发生安全事件时能够快速响应和处置。
### 5.4 定期进行安全评估
组织应定期进行网络安全评估,识别潜在的安全隐患,并及时进行整改。例如,通过渗透测试和漏洞扫描,发现网络接口和应用层协议的安全漏洞,并及时进行修复。
## 六、案例分析
### 6.1 案例一:某电商平台的网络接口监控
某电商平台在高峰期遭遇了大量异常流量攻击,导致服务器瘫痪。事后分析发现,该平台未对网络接口进行全面的流量监控,未能及时发现异常流量。引入AI技术后,通过实时流量分析和异常检测,成功识别并阻断了多次异常流量攻击。
### 6.2 案例二:某金融系统的应用层协议监控
某金融系统在运行过程中,频繁出现恶意代码注入事件,导致用户数据泄露。经分析发现,该系统未对应用层协议进行细致的监控,未能及时发现恶意代码。引入AI技术后,通过深度学习算法对请求内容进行恶意代码识别,成功拦截了大量恶意请求。
## 七、结论
网络接口和应用层协议的监控是保障网络安全的重要环节,设定最小必要的监控指标是确保监控有效性的关键。通过引入AI技术,可以显著提升监控的精准性和实时性,有效识别和防范潜在的安全威胁。组织应建立完善的监控体系,加强人员培训与应急响应,定期进行安全评估,确保网络系统的安全稳定运行。
在数字化时代,网络安全形势日益复杂,只有不断优化监控策略,积极引入先进技术,才能有效应对各种安全挑战,保障数据的安全和系统的稳定。希望本文的分析和建议能够为相关组织和从业者提供有益的参考。